What's Staveley like for family-friendly holidays?
The welcoming destination of Staveley is a great choice if you've been considering a holiday with the children. The lake views, coffee shops and hiking trails are just a few things that make this an attractive spot for a family holiday.
When's the best time to book a family-friendly holiday in Staveley?
The hottest months are usually July and August, with an average temperature of 12°C, while the coldest months are January and February, with an average of 3°C. Average annual precipitation for Staveley is 1450 mm.
What's there to see and do with your family in Staveley?
While you are visiting Staveley, you may want to round up the youngsters and make time to see interesting attractions such as World of Beatrix Potter and Windermere Jetty Museum of Boats, Steam and Stories. Make sure that you have lots of time for activities such as Blackwell, The Arts & Crafts House and Brockhole - the Lake District Visitor Centre.
What's the best way for us to get around Staveley?
If you want to explore the larger area, hop on a train at Staveley Station. Staveley may not have many public transport choices, so consider a car rental to maximise your time.
